Bachelor of Physiotherapy (BPT)

Eligible Criteria:

  • Must have studied Physics, Chemistry and Biology subjects from a recognized educational institution and passed with a minimum of 50% or 2.4 CGPA in the Proficiency Certificate Level or Grade 12 Science Group. or Students from A-level or other similar programs with different grading systems should have studied Physics, Chemistry and Biology subjects and passed with a minimum of 50 percent or 2.4 CGPA. or Proficiency Certificate Level / Diploma in Health Science (Ayurveda or Medical Lab Technology or Radiography or Physiotherapy or Pharmacy or Ophthalmic Science) with minimum 50% marks in aggregate (for applying in related academic program like BSc MLT from CMLT, B Pharm from Diploma in Pharmacy) or Proficiency Certificate/Diploma in Health Science (Medical Lab Technology or Ophthalmic Science or Dental Science or Pharmacy or Radiography or Ayurveda or Physiotherapy) with minimum 50% marks in aggregate and having studied Physics, Chemistry and Biology subject with minimum 50% in aggregate from National Examination Board Percent or 2.4 CGPA (CGPA) marks and obtained the equivalence of class 12th science group and should be registered in the concerned council.

About Program:

Physiotherapy is the health profession integral to all health across the lifespan that promotes the well being of an individual through health promotion, prevention and rehabilitation that encompasses physical, psychological, emotional, social and environmental factors. physiotherapy provides services to individuals and the community where mobility and functioning are or may be threatened due to injury, pain, illness, dysfunction or environmental factors. Physiotherapy is based on physiotherapy science and it applies to research and knowledge from many other fields (e.g., medical science, health sciences, physical education, social and behavioral sciences). The art and science of physiotherapy are used in the treatment of patients with the disease, disability or injury and aim to achieve and maintain optimal functional capacity. Physiotherapists need to understand human functional abilities and limitations.
